Handover Note — Director Transition (Amsel to Piret)

The second-source search for our Larkspur resin supply is midstream. Two candidates, Ostwick Polymers and Dunmere Chemical, have passed initial audits; sample runs begin shortly. Budget and timelines are in the shared tracker. Please weigh the following carefully before awarding anything.

management briefing: The renewal with Zoraelax Group closes at $10 million a year, 15 percent below the last contract. Project Ralael slips by six weeks because of the audit delay.

HANDOVER NOTE — Permit Blueprints

For the Greyfen Annex receiving desk:

Tube contains the full blueprint set for the Orrell Quay permit filing — four sheets, stamped, plus the structural addendum. Do not unroll before the planning meeting; creases void the stamp per the Delmont council's rules. Log receipt on arrival and store flat in the plan cabinet, not the rack. Courier arrives midday. Hand-over instruction is below.

courier memo of yawep-yafog: the pramir ulaix courier leaves the ulavan aldix frair zorok oliiel joreth rusdor fenvan ledger at gate 1305 under passcode 514738

## Configuration — Driftline Tide Widget

Before cutting a release, double-check the env file. `TIDE_REGION` picks the forecast zone and `REFRESH_MINUTES` defaults to 30 — don't go lower, the upstream gauge service gets grumpy. Everything else has sane defaults baked in. The only sensitive bit is the gauge-service credential, which goes on the very next line of the file.

secret setting of yafof-tawep: RELAY_SECRET8=8abb5772